ITASCA, IL — The Federation of Indian Associations Chicago (FIA) celebrated India’s 69th Republic Day by holding a Community Event at the Shree Swaminarayan Temple, Itasca, Illinois on January 28.
The event, which featured a blood donation drive, a health camp, information on medicare, information on taxation, college counselling, and passport and visa help, was attended by over 1,000 people from the community who took advantage of the various services offered.

Neil Khot, current president, announced that this type of event would be the ongoing theme for the FIA. He also announced the opening of non-emergency FIA Toll Free number 1 (833) FIA CARE.
